Transaction 8765f616bf770338ad3d4603ad681eecec565104f5f04ac931997c59a0d48a97
1 Input
2 Outputs
- 8765f616bf770338ad3d4603ad681eecec565104f5f04ac931997c59a0d48a97:0
- 8765f616bf770338ad3d4603ad681eecec565104f5f04ac931997c59a0d48a97:1
value 257450
address 3BQuNDKbgevciyQwx3BPAQhT4cht3eiUct
value 269564
address 1DDPuxx4W1JJMvRZ6c2vHosWFTaMYg5wKP